Visibility and exposure at this high traffic 4-way stoplight intersectoin is prime! The location on US Highway 41 (Calumet Avenue) is a corner lot at the intersection of US41, 6th Street Extension and Lake Linden Avenue. The commercial building has two main rooms which could be divided up if separate offices were needed or are very functional as they are currently set up. There is also one restroom, storage room and mechanical room. There are three entrances to the building, including the front foyer. The paved parking lot has access from both US41 and Lake Linden Avenue. The building has a metal roof (approx 18+/- years) and natural gas forced air heat/central air (approx. 13+/- years). Attic area provides some storage. Main area is approx 27x19. Conference room/office is approx 29x17. Year Built: Originally Built in 1982 and the addition in 2000. The property is subject to a Michigan Department of Transportation Carpool Parking Lot Contract. Calumet is located in Michigan. Calumet, Michigan has a population of 768. Calumet is less family-centric than the surrounding county with 29.81% of the households containing married families with children. The county average for households married with children is 30.83%.
The median household income in Calumet, Michigan is $19,028. The median household income for the surrounding county is $48,623 compared to the national median of $69,021. The median age of people living in Calumet is 35.8 years.
The average high temperature in July is 75.6 degrees, with an average low temperature in January of 6.6 degrees. The average rainfall is approximately 31.4 inches per year, with 207.6 inches of snow per year.
